Rocketman Rocketman

Dexter Fletcher / United Kingdom, Canada, USA / 2019 / 121 min / English

An epic musical fantasy about the incredible story of Elton John’s breakthrough years. The film follows the fantastical journey of transformation from shy piano prodigy Reginald Dwight into an international superstar. Set to Elton John’s most beloved songs and performed by Taron Egerton, Rocketman tells the universally relatable story of how a small-town boy became one of the most iconic figures in pop culture.
